Why Lawn Aeration Is One of the Best Investments You Can Make
Many people focus only on what they see above the ground, but the real health of your lawn begins several inches below the surface. Healthy roots require air pockets within the soil to expand, absorb nutrients, and access moisture. Over time those air pockets disappear as soil becomes compressed.
Core aeration restores those air spaces naturally without damaging your existing lawn. The small plugs removed during the process break down naturally, returning beneficial organic matter to the soil while creating channels that allow roots to expand deeper.
The result is a lawn that becomes stronger from the ground up instead of simply appearing greener for a few weeks after fertilizer is applied.

Core Aeration vs. Spike Aeration: What’s the Difference?
Not all lawn aeration methods produce the same results. Many homeowners have heard of spike aeration, where solid spikes punch holes into the ground. While this may appear beneficial, spike aeration can actually increase soil compaction by forcing surrounding soil tighter together.
At Jevin’s Landscaping, we recommend core aeration, which physically removes small plugs of soil from the lawn. Removing these cores creates thousands of open channels that allow air, water, fertilizer, and nutrients to reach the root zone while reducing soil compaction naturally.
For most lawns throughout Lynnwood and Snohomish County, professional core aeration provides significantly longer-lasting results than spike aeration.

What is core lawn aeration?
Core aeration removes thousands of small plugs of soil from your lawn, relieving compaction and allowing air, water, fertilizer, and nutrients to reach the root system more effectively.
How often should my lawn be aerated?
Most lawns throughout Lynnwood benefit from professional aeration once each year. Lawns with heavy foot traffic, compacted clay soils, or significant drainage issues may benefit from more frequent aeration depending on conditions.
When is the best time to aerate a lawn?
Spring and fall are typically the best times to aerate lawns in Western Washington because cooler temperatures and regular rainfall encourage healthy root growth and successful recovery.
Should I overseed after aeration?
Yes. Aeration creates excellent seed-to-soil contact, making it one of the best times to overseed and thicken your lawn while improving long-term turf health.
Can aeration help reduce moss?
Yes. While moss has multiple causes, improving soil health, drainage, and turf density through aeration often helps reduce conditions that allow moss to thrive.
Will aeration damage my lawn?
No. Core aeration is designed to improve lawn health. The small soil plugs naturally break down over time while helping improve soil structure and root development.
Can aeration improve drainage?
Yes. Aeration allows water to move more effectively into the soil instead of pooling on the surface, improving drainage while encouraging deeper root growth.
